springboot 集成金蝶云星空
时间: 2023-09-16 09:15:10 浏览: 261
您好!对于Spring Boot集成金蝶云星空,您可以按照以下步骤进行操作:
1. 首先,您需要在金蝶云星空开放平台注册一个应用并获取到应用的AppKey和AppSecret,这些信息将在后续的集成过程中使用。
2. 在您的Spring Boot项目中,添加相关依赖。您可以通过在pom.xml文件中添加以下依赖引入相关功能:
```xml
<dependency>
<groupId>com.kingdee</groupId>
<artifactId>dtk-openplatform-sdk</artifactId>
<version>1.0.0</version>
</dependency>
```
3. 创建一个配置类,用于配置金蝶云星空的相关信息。在该配置类中,您可以将之前获取到的AppKey和AppSecret配置到相应的属性中,例如:
```java
import com.kingdee.dtk.api.OpenAPI;
import org.springframework.beans.factory.annotation.Value;
import org.springframework.context.annotation.Bean;
import org.springframework.context.annotation.Configuration;
@Configuration
public class KingdeeConfig {
@Value("${kingdee.appKey}")
private String appKey;
@Value("${kingdee.appSecret}")
private String appSecret;
@Bean
public OpenAPI openAPI() {
return new OpenAPI(appKey, appSecret);
}
}
```
4. 在需要使用金蝶云星空功能的地方,注入OpenAPI对象,并调用相应的方法进行操作。例如:
```java
import com.kingdee.dtk.api.OpenAPI;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Service;
@Service
public class KingdeeService {
@Autowired
private OpenAPI openAPI;
public void someMethod() {
// 调用金蝶云星空的API进行相应操作
// 例如:openAPI.xxx();
}
}
```
以上是一个简单的示例,您可以根据实际需求,调用金蝶云星空提供的API进行更多操作。希望对您有所帮助!如有任何问题,请随时追问。
阅读全文